Someone has done a wild repair in this sewing machine, looks like they've used epoxy resin to fix a small crack, then just spread the rest around for fun.

I don't know anything about resin, and only a bit about motors. I have 2 questions please:

1) The resin is blocking about 1/4 of the ventilation holes for the motor. Will this affect the motor's ability to cool down?

2) Is this amount of resin in general bad for the motor? Is it affected by heat?

@rosalindwyatt although not pretty, this somewhat sloppy repair should not impeded the function of the motor. You could go ahead and use something like a Dremel like tool and remove the excessive resin.
